Twitter on Tuesday said that the platform saw a record number of tweets and conversations after the passing away of Queen Elizabeth II on September 8 at the age of 96.

Since the Queen's passing, there have been over 30.2 million tweets about the Queen.

The day of the announcement on September 8 was the highest volume of conversation ever seen on the micro-blogging platform.

"On September 8, there were over 11.1 million tweets about the Queen, with @RoyalFamily being the 4th most globally mentioned handle," said the micro-blogging platform.

There were over 1 million tweets about queues and the #1 hashtag within this conversation was #queueforthequeen.

 "The top Retweeted Tweet so far has been The Royal Family's announcement of the Queen's death," said the company.
